Namibia - Population ages 60-64, male (% of male population)
The value for Population ages 60-64, male (% of male population) in Namibia was 1.71 as of 2020. As the graph below shows, over the past 60 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 2.14 in 1961 and a minimum value of 1.43 in 2000.
Definition: Male population between the ages 60 to 64 as a percentage of the total male population.
Source: World Bank staff estimates based on age/sex distributions of United Nations Population Division's World Population Prospects: 2019 Revision.
